A beautifully presented second-floor studio apartment, forming part of a highly regarded development in the heart of Broxbourne - just a short walk from Broxbourne Station, local shops, and riverside walks along the Lea Valley.
The property offers bright, well-designed accommodation with an excellent sense of space, including an open-plan kitchen/living area fitted with modern units, integrated appliances, and sleek work surfaces. There is a separate sleeping area with space for wardrobes, and a superb bathroom/W.C. Finished to a contemporary standard.
Further benefits include underfloor heating, double-glazed windows, a video entry system, and allocated parking, together with an additional private storage unit.
This superb apartment combines stylish presentation with an ultra-convenient location - ideal for first-time buyers, investors, or commuters seeking a low-maintenance home within minutes of the station.
